Career Role in Genomic Medicine (UK) Description
Genomic Data Scientist Analyze large genomic datasets, develop predictive models, and contribute to cutting-edge genomic research. High demand in the bioinformatics and pharmaceutical sectors.
Genomic Consultant Interpret genomic data for clinicians, providing essential insights for personalized medicine and patient care. Requires expertise in genetics and counseling.
Bioinformatician Develop and implement computational tools for genomic data analysis. In high demand across research institutions and biotech companies. Strong programming skills are crucial.
Clinical Geneticist Diagnose and manage genetic disorders. A highly specialized role requiring significant medical training and expertise in genetics.
Genetic Counselor Provide support and guidance to patients and families facing genetic conditions. This involves interpreting genetic information and providing counseling.

Certificate Programme in Genomic Medicine Collaboration is increasingly significant in today's rapidly evolving healthcare landscape. The UK, a global leader in genomic research, is witnessing an exponential growth in genomic data and its applications. According to the Genomics England 100,000 Genomes Project, over 100,000 whole genomes have been sequenced, generating invaluable data for research and personalized medicine. This surge underscores the critical need for professionals skilled in genomic data analysis, interpretation, and ethical considerations. Collaboration within multidisciplinary teams is paramount, making this certificate programme invaluable.
